Output cc728142f97fa9cea2ee132a19de96bbf0b3e4bfeb6e4eed5993a4a6f4cd66f0:3

value
134528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59a24ce14e0ca9e8fcdf42e000f5cf08e213fc90 OP_EQUAL
address
39rxVSUjg4ATJNkxgGpX3U7H8ggRLMALzD
transaction
cc728142f97fa9cea2ee132a19de96bbf0b3e4bfeb6e4eed5993a4a6f4cd66f0
confirmations
171059
spent
true